angular - 使用 Nginx 未正确路由为具有特定位置的 Angular 应用程序提供服务
问题描述
我绝对缺乏关于 Nginx 和所有这些部署内容的知识......当遇到特定位置时,我试图提供一个角度,所以在我的服务器配置中,default.conf
我试图这样做:
location /app/ {
index index.html;
alias /usr/share/nginx/html/;
try_files $uri$args $uri$args $uri $uri/ /app/index.html;
...
当我去的时候它加载得很好,domain.com/app/
但是当我做类似的事情domain.com/app/?query_params
或者domain.com/app/route
它只是提供主页("domain.com/app/")
时,就像angular-routing
它不工作一样。
你能为我指出正确的方向吗?提前致谢!
解决方案
推荐阅读
- javascript - 使用 Promise 的内置方式,而不是添加事件监听器
- reactjs - 使用酶测试 Redux + React 应用程序的问题:
- python - 使用元素树为嵌套 XML 创建唯一代码
- php - 使用变量和文本 php /codeigniter 发送表单字段名称
- excel - Countif 不会正确复制或更新
- android - 如何使用 apk 路径执行“flutter run”?
- c++ - 如何将“返回”功能编程为 QT 中 MainWindow 的菜单栏选项?
- discord - 如何在不和谐中为用户添加角色?
- html - 角度下拉菜单为空
- node.js - 我的 node.js 应用程序将如何访问上传的图像?